Searched refs:amdgpu_ib (Results 1 – 16 of 16) sorted by relevance
| /linux/drivers/gpu/drm/amd/amdgpu/ |
| H A D | amdgpu_ring.h | 34 struct amdgpu_ib; 102 struct amdgpu_ib { struct 240 struct amdgpu_ib *ib); 243 struct amdgpu_ib *ib); 250 struct amdgpu_ib *ib, 270 void (*pad_ib)(struct amdgpu_ring *ring, struct amdgpu_ib *ib); 468 void amdgpu_ring_generic_pad_ib(struct amdgpu_ring *ring, struct amdgpu_ib *ib); 556 static inline u32 amdgpu_ib_get_value(struct amdgpu_ib *ib, int idx) in amdgpu_ib_get_value() 561 static inline void amdgpu_ib_set_value(struct amdgpu_ib *ib, int idx, in amdgpu_ib_set_value() 570 struct amdgpu_ib *ib); [all …]
|
| H A D | vcn_v2_0.h | 33 struct amdgpu_ib *ib, uint32_t flags); 46 struct amdgpu_ib *ib, uint32_t flags);
|
| H A D | amdgpu_ib.c | 66 struct amdgpu_ib *ib) in amdgpu_ib_get() 97 void amdgpu_ib_free(struct amdgpu_ib *ib, struct dma_fence *f) in amdgpu_ib_free() 125 struct amdgpu_ib *ibs, struct amdgpu_job *job, in amdgpu_ib_schedule() 129 struct amdgpu_ib *ib = &ibs[0]; in amdgpu_ib_schedule()
|
| H A D | vcn_sw_ring.h | 36 struct amdgpu_ib *ib, uint32_t flags);
|
| H A D | jpeg_v4_0_3.h | 60 struct amdgpu_ib *ib,
|
| H A D | amdgpu_vm.h | 225 void (*copy_pte)(struct amdgpu_ib *ib, 230 void (*write_pte)(struct amdgpu_ib *ib, uint64_t pe, 234 void (*set_pte_pde)(struct amdgpu_ib *ib,
|
| H A D | amdgpu_uvd.h | 88 struct amdgpu_ib *ib);
|
| H A D | vcn_sw_ring.c | 45 struct amdgpu_ib *ib, uint32_t flags) in vcn_dec_sw_ring_emit_ib()
|
| H A D | sdma_v6_0.c | 267 struct amdgpu_ib *ib, in sdma_v6_0_ring_emit_ib() 984 struct amdgpu_ib ib; in sdma_v6_0_ring_test_ib() 1060 static void sdma_v6_0_vm_copy_pte(struct amdgpu_ib *ib, in sdma_v6_0_vm_copy_pte() 1088 static void sdma_v6_0_vm_write_pte(struct amdgpu_ib *ib, uint64_t pe, in sdma_v6_0_vm_write_pte() 1118 static void sdma_v6_0_vm_set_pte_pde(struct amdgpu_ib *ib, in sdma_v6_0_vm_set_pte_pde() 1143 static void sdma_v6_0_ring_pad_ib(struct amdgpu_ring *ring, struct amdgpu_ib *ib) in sdma_v6_0_ring_pad_ib() 1841 static void sdma_v6_0_emit_copy_buffer(struct amdgpu_ib *ib, in sdma_v6_0_emit_copy_buffer() 1868 static void sdma_v6_0_emit_fill_buffer(struct amdgpu_ib *ib, in sdma_v6_0_emit_fill_buffer()
|
| H A D | sdma_v5_0.c | 432 struct amdgpu_ib *ib, in sdma_v5_0_ring_emit_ib() 1077 struct amdgpu_ib ib; in sdma_v5_0_ring_test_ib() 1154 static void sdma_v5_0_vm_copy_pte(struct amdgpu_ib *ib, in sdma_v5_0_vm_copy_pte() 1182 static void sdma_v5_0_vm_write_pte(struct amdgpu_ib *ib, uint64_t pe, in sdma_v5_0_vm_write_pte() 1212 static void sdma_v5_0_vm_set_pte_pde(struct amdgpu_ib *ib, in sdma_v5_0_vm_set_pte_pde() 1237 static void sdma_v5_0_ring_pad_ib(struct amdgpu_ring *ring, struct amdgpu_ib *ib) in sdma_v5_0_ring_pad_ib() 1998 static void sdma_v5_0_emit_copy_buffer(struct amdgpu_ib *ib, in sdma_v5_0_emit_copy_buffer() 2025 static void sdma_v5_0_emit_fill_buffer(struct amdgpu_ib *ib, in sdma_v5_0_emit_fill_buffer()
|
| H A D | sdma_v5_2.c | 280 struct amdgpu_ib *ib, in sdma_v5_2_ring_emit_ib() 977 struct amdgpu_ib ib; in sdma_v5_2_ring_test_ib() 1053 static void sdma_v5_2_vm_copy_pte(struct amdgpu_ib *ib, in sdma_v5_2_vm_copy_pte() 1081 static void sdma_v5_2_vm_write_pte(struct amdgpu_ib *ib, uint64_t pe, in sdma_v5_2_vm_write_pte() 1111 static void sdma_v5_2_vm_set_pte_pde(struct amdgpu_ib *ib, in sdma_v5_2_vm_set_pte_pde() 1137 static void sdma_v5_2_ring_pad_ib(struct amdgpu_ring *ring, struct amdgpu_ib *ib) in sdma_v5_2_ring_pad_ib() 2002 static void sdma_v5_2_emit_copy_buffer(struct amdgpu_ib *ib, in sdma_v5_2_emit_copy_buffer() 2029 static void sdma_v5_2_emit_fill_buffer(struct amdgpu_ib *ib, in sdma_v5_2_emit_fill_buffer()
|
| H A D | amdgpu_jpeg.c | 193 struct amdgpu_ib *ib; in amdgpu_jpeg_dec_set_reg() 566 struct amdgpu_ib *ib) in amdgpu_jpeg_dec_parse_cs()
|
| H A D | amdgpu_amdkfd.c | 653 struct amdgpu_ib *ib; in amdgpu_amdkfd_submit_ib() 679 memset(ib, 0, sizeof(struct amdgpu_ib)); in amdgpu_amdkfd_submit_ib()
|
| H A D | amdgpu_cs.c | 347 struct amdgpu_ib *ib; in amdgpu_cs_p2_ib() 1032 struct amdgpu_ib *ib = &job->ibs[i]; in amdgpu_cs_patch_ibs()
|
| H A D | amdgpu_ring.c | 166 void amdgpu_ring_generic_pad_ib(struct amdgpu_ring *ring, struct amdgpu_ib *ib) in amdgpu_ring_generic_pad_ib()
|
| H A D | gfx_v12_0.c | 496 struct amdgpu_ib ib; in gfx_v12_0_ring_test_ib() 4411 struct amdgpu_ib *ib, in gfx_v12_0_ring_emit_ib_gfx() 4434 struct amdgpu_ib *ib, in gfx_v12_0_ring_emit_ib_compute()
|